N2 - This paper describes how AND/OR graph has been introduced as a systematic assembly sequence planning to senior mechanical engineering students at United Arab Emirates University. The students were introduced to AND/OR graph through Matrix Manipulations. They were then given hands on experience in the assembling of a bearing puller. A practical mid-term examination in the assembly planning of a Three-pin plug was given as the examination task. The results were excellent in that 43 out of 51 scored more than 90%. The encouraging results suggest that AND/OR graph is a suitable method for assembly planning.
